Herunterladen Inhalt Inhalt Diese Seite drucken

Programmbeispiel Zur Alarmverarbeitung - Siemens simatic s5-115u Handbuch

Vorschau ausblenden Andere Handbücher für simatic s5-115u:
Inhaltsverzeichnis

Werbung

Handbuch
Alarmverarbeitung
9.2.5
Programmbeispiel zur Alarmverarbeitung
Aufgabe
Ein Förderkorb soll an zwei Stellen genau positioniert werden:
Position 1 i s t festgelegt durch Endschalter 1.
Wenn der Signalzustand des Endschalters 1 von
0
nach
1
wechselt (positive Flanke), soll der
Antrieb 1 ausgeschaltet werden.
Position 2 i s t festgelegt durch Endschalter 2.
Wenn der Signalzustand des Endschalters 2 von
1
nach
0
wechselt (negative Flanke), soll der
Antrieb 2 ausgeschaltet werden.
Der Zustand der Endschalter soll durch zwei Meldeleuchten angezeigt werden:
Meldeleuchte
1
für "Signalzustand des Endschalters 1 ",
Meldeleuchte 2 für "Signalzustand des Endschalters
2".
Realisierung
Die Baugruppe 434-7 hat die Anfangsadresse 8. Die IM 306 i s t für die 434-7 auf 16 Kanale
eingestellt.
Endschalter 1 i s t dem Kanal
0,
Endschalter 2 i s t dem Kanal
1
der Baugruppe zugeordnet.
Die Anlauf-Programme OB21 und OB22 haben die Aufgabe, die Baugruppe zu parametrieren:
Die Alarme werden im OB2 ausgewertet:
L
K M
0000 0011 0000 0010
T
PW
8
BE
Antrieb
1
wird durch Rücksetzen des Ausgangs A
0.0
ausgeschaltet,
Antrieb 2 wird durch Rücksetzen des Ausgangs A
0 . 1
ausgeschaltet.
Parametrierung der Alarmeingaenge:
Freiqabe Kanal 0: positive Flanke
Freigabe Kanal 1: negative Flanke
Der Zustand der Meldeleuchten wird im zyklischen Programmteil aktualisiert:
Wenn Ausgang A l
-0
gesetzt ist, leuchtet Meldeleuchte
4,
wenn Ausgang A l
.I
gesetzt ist, leuchtet Meldeleuchte 2.

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is